The Limbaži District ( Limbažu novads ) is an administrative district in Latvia , north of Riga in the Vidzeme region.

Location and geography

The Limbaži district borders the Gulf of Riga at Skulte for 5.8 km . The adjacent administrative districts are clockwise: Salacgrīva , Aloja , Valmiera , Pārgauja , Krimulda , Sēja and Saulkrasti .

The Limbaži district is partly located in the North Vidzeme Biosphere Reserve . The rural area is rich in lakes. A railway line from Skulte to Rūjiena was shut down.

Structure and population

As part of an administrative reform in 2009, the old Limbaži district was dissolved and a new administrative district was created. In addition to the city of Limbaži with 7983 inhabitants (as of July 1, 2014) on an area of ​​almost 9 km², it also includes the seven surrounding communities (pagasts)

  • Katvari with 1267 inhabitants on 125 km²,
  • Limbaži with 2369 inhabitants on 228 km²,
  • Pāle with 795 inhabitants on 146 km²,
  • Skulte with 2061 inhabitants on 146 km²,
  • Umurga with 1154 inhabitants on 190 km²,
  • Vidriži with 1475 inhabitants on 106 km² and
  • Viļķene with 1311 inhabitants on 225 km².

On July 1, 2010, 19,548 inhabitants were registered in the administrative district (around 90% of Latvian nationality), of which almost 8,500 people lived in the city of Limbaži alone. On July 1, 2014, there were still 18,415 residents in the Limbaži district, 7,983 of them in the city itself.
